Position Overview
Join the Mt. Hood Meadows Public Safety team and play an important role in protecting one of Oregon's premier mountain resorts. As a Public Safety Officer, you'll help create a safe, secure, and welcoming environment for our guests, employees, and property while working in the stunning setting of Mt. Hood. This entry-level position offers a unique blend of patrol responsibilities, emergency response, guest interaction, and operational support in a fast-paced mountain environment.
As a Public Safety Officer, you'll conduct safety rounds, respond to incidents and emergencies, assist Ski Patrol with medical transport, support loss prevention efforts, and collaborate with local law enforcement and emergency services when needed. You'll document incidents, help manage traffic and parking operations, assist with snow removal activities, and contribute to the overall safety and efficiency of resort operations. This role requires someone who can remain calm under pressure, exercise sound judgment, and adapt quickly to changing weather and operational conditions.
